# Env file — Cartwheel dispatch, driver-assignment heuristic
# Scope: staging only. Do not promote to prod.
# The heuristic weights (proximity, shift balance, refusal rate) are tuned
# for the Velmont pilot region and will misbehave elsewhere.
# Review notes: heuristic service runs unprivileged; it reads weights
# read-only from the tuning store and writes nothing back.
# Only one sensitive value exists in this file: the tuning-store access
# credential, consumed at boot and never logged.
# That credential is set on the following line.

secret setting of faduf-bahop: LEDGER_TOKEN8=c3b363be

**Q: My plugin's config changes aren't hot-reloading in Threnody. Why?**

A: Threnody watches the plugin config directory and applies changes within five seconds. If reloads stall, the watcher's state vault has likely locked after a crash — common on the Marlow build. Don't restart the host; you'll drop other plugins. Instead, run the vault-unlock command from the plugin SDK and supply the recovery passphrase. It is provided immediately below for registered authors.

strongbox words: praath-queniel-holax-druael-jorath-noveth-druok

Handover — Relay Gateway Compression

To whoever picks up Fennic Relay from me: we enable permessage-deflate on websocket connections, which cuts bandwidth roughly 60% on chatty clients but costs CPU and adds per-connection memory for the compression context. Support should know that disabling compression is the first lever when a node shows memory pressure — latency impact is minor. Mobile clients on the Orvane app negotiate it automatically. The current production settings for the compression layer are shown below.

deployment values, kajep-kageg:
[praix]
host = praix.paliqcorp.corp
user = praix_svc
database = praix_prod